Ok, I got myself into a messed up situation last night. I am currently waiting on my letter for my CCL. Last night I got pulled over and ticketed for open container(beer) and transporting a loaded firearm. I'm not looking for a lecture, I know what I did was stupid.

The way I have it figured is worst case senario I pay my fines and have to wait another 3 years before sending off again.

Here is what I am wondering, If I were to get my letter in the next week, are those charges something that would get your CCL revovked? Is there any other input I should know or think about(other than not having a beer on the way to a buddy's house?)

Get an attorney. It sounds like it may be a municipal charge wherein your attorney can probably negotiate a six month probation with a dismissal or an amendment to disorderly conduct. Dont go in and plead guilty. Just some lawyerly advice!
